About The Position

An OPEX accountant handles the financial aspects of day-to-day operational expenses and capital expenditures within the company. Primary responsibilities include managing and analyzing business expenses, ensuring accurate recording in financial statements, delivering reports to relevant departments, and providing insights to optimize operational costs.

Responsibilities

  • Review and process invoices and related cover sheets from various departments and input all data in accounting system (SAP R3)
  • Preparing operational expenditure payment batch
  • Reviewing and verifying expense reports for various departments to ensure compliance with generally accepted accounting principles and company policies
  • Reconciling operational expense accounts to ensure accuracy and identify any discrepancies
  • Managing prepaid expense, accrued expense and accrued account schedule
  • Managing and tracking corporate fixed asset with depreciation schedule
  • Managing, monitoring and reconciling operational support inventory
  • Performing monthly, quarterly, and annual closing
  • Preparing and analyzing financial statements related to operation expenses, including balance sheets and income statements
  • Analyze spending trends and variances to identify areas for cost reduction or improvement
  • Other special projects as assigned.
